-
Java实现插入排序详细代码
/***插入排序 *@author g0rez *@data 2021-05-13 *最佳情况:T(n)= O(n) 最坏情况:T(n)= O(n2) 平均情况:T(n)= O(n2)*/ public class 插...
-
Java经典排序算法之插入排序
-
插入排序法的java代码
算法设计实验一归并排序(分治)和插入排序的比较分析动画演示C语言冒泡排序算法精品PPT课件(绝对精品)2.4 可以复用的代码北理工数据结构实验报告4南开20秋学期《数据库技术与程序设计》在线...
-
插入排序介绍和java代码实现
介绍插入排序的概念、特点、优缺点、适用场景和java代码简单实现 资源推荐 资源详情 资源评论 插入排序介绍 概念:插入排序是一种简单直观的排序算法,它将待排序的元素分为已排序和未排...
-
使用java代码和伪代码实现插入排序
本文由java入门程序栏目为大家介绍如何通过java实现和伪代码实现插入排序,希望可以帮助到有需要的同学。通常我们会使用for循环与...
-
java插入排序代码解析
gfghpk 2013.08.01 浏览960次 JAVA语言 以下是代码,应该是插入排序的吧: public class InjectionSort { public static void injectionSort(int[]number){ for(int j=1;j;j+){ int ...
-
插入排序总结及Java代码实现
插入排序根据实现方法,又分为直接插入排序(Straight Insertion Sort)和希尔排序(采用分治,Shell`s Sort)。二者时间复杂度、空间复杂度及稳定性如下: 1.直接插入排序(Straight Insertion Sort) 基本思想: 基本思想: 将一个记录插入到已排序好的有序表中,从而得到一个新的记录数增1的有序表。即:先将序列的第1个记录看成是一个有序的子序列,然后从第2个记录逐个进行插入,直至整个序列有序
-
java实现插入排序
细化来说:对于一个有n个元素的数据序列,排序需要进行n-1趟插入操作,如下所示:] 第1趟插入:将第2个元素插入前面的有序子序列中,此时前面只有一个元素,当然是有序的. 第2趟插入:将第3个元素插入前面的有序子序列中,前面两个元素是有序的. . 第2趟插入:将第3个元素插入前面的有序子序列中,前面两个元素是有序的. . 第n-1趟插入:将第n个元素插入前面的有序子序列中,前面n-1个元素是有序的.
-
插入排序的Java代码实现
文章标签:数据结构与算法 java shell 插入排序也是一类非常常见的排序方法,它主要包含直接插入排序,Shell排序和折半插入排序等几种常见的排序方法. 1.直接插入排序 直接插入排序的思...
浏览更多安心,自主掌握个人信息!
我们尊重您的隐私,只浏览不追踪